Gregg Kallor & Adriana Zabala - Tuesday Musical

Tuesday Musical welcomes pianist and composer Gregg Kallor back to Akron following an outstanding FUZE! concert in 2014. This concert will feature many of Gregg's compositions and other more familiar works as he collaborates with mezzo soprano Adriana Zabala.

Kallor is a composer and pianist whose music fuses the classical and jazz traditions he loves into a new, deeply personal language. Kallor received an Aaron Copland Award for composition in 2011; he wrote a concerto for piano and orchestra during his residency at the home of the late eminent American composer. Kallor is also the inaugural Composer-In-Residence at SubCulture in New York City, a two-year residency which will feature world premieres of three new pieces and collaborations with cellist Joshua Roman, violinist Miranda Cuckson, mezzo-soprano Adriana Zabala, and baritone Matthew Worth.
